The Taichung International Convention and Exhibition Center (TICEC) is a convention center in Shuinan Economic and Trade Park, Taichung, Taiwan. The convention center was completed in September 2024. Designed to bolster the region's economic and trade activities, TICEC is poised to become a central hub for international conferences, exhibitions, and events.
The concept of TICEC was introduced to enhance Taichung's "front-shop, back-factory" industrial advantage, aiming to elevate the city's global profile and stimulate related sectors such as tourism, hospitality, and transportation. Construction of the eastern exhibition hall commenced in March 2019, with the facility's inauguration slated for 2025.
Spanning approximately 7.34 ha (18.1 acres), the eastern exhibition hall of TICEC offers a total floor area exceeding 130,000 m2 . The facility is divided into two primary sections: the Exhibition Hall and the Conference Center.
- Exhibition Hall: This area encompasses five above-ground levels and two basement levels dedicated to parking. The first and fourth floors each accommodate up to 800 standard exhibition booths, with the fourth floor also adaptable for performance events. The remaining floors feature open spaces suitable for various exhibition configurations.
- Conference Center: Comprising four levels, the center includes a multifunctional conference hall on the first floor with movable seating for 2,400 attendees. The second to fourth floors house the International Conference Center, equipped with fixed seating for 2,200 participants. An aerial garden graces the fifth level, providing a serene environment for informal gatherings.
